About Dr. Kenneth Finn

Dr. Kenneth Finn, M.D., is board certified in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ation, Pain Medicine, and Pain Management.

He has served on the Colorado Governor’s Task Force on Amendment 64 and the Colorado Medical Marijuana Scientific Advisory Council, bringing extensive experience to the discussion of cannabis, medicine, regulation, and public health.

His leadership roles within the American Board of Pain Medicine further reflect his expertise in pain medicine, clinical care, and responsible professional education.
